Regular physical activity and exercise (PA) are cornerstones of diabetes care for individuals with type 1 diabetes. In recent years, the availability of automated insulin delivery (AID) systems has improved the ability of people with type 1 diabetes to achieve the recommended glucose target ranges. PA provide additional health benefits but can cause glucose fluctuations, which challenges current AID systems. While an increasing number of clinical trials and reviews are being published on different AID systems and PA, it seems prudent at this time to collate this information and develop a position statement on the topic. This joint European Association for the Study of Diabetes (EASD)/International Society for Pediatric and Adolescent Diabetes (ISPAD) position statement reviews current evidence on AID systems and provides detailed clinical practice points for managing PA in children, adolescents and adults with type 1 diabetes using AID technology. It discusses each commercially available AID system individually and provides guidance on their use in PA. Additionally, it addresses different glucose responses to PA and provides stratified therapy options to maintain glucose levels within the target ranges for these age groups.

Objective: This study aimed to evaluate the diabetic eye disease screening continuum at two academic centers and identify its barriers.
Research Design And Methods: We analyzed health records from the University of California, San Francisco and University of California, Irvine to identify primary care patients needing diabetic eye screening. We tracked referrals, screenings, diagnoses, and treatments to evaluate predictors and the impact of an automated referral system.

Objective: This study investigates the mechanisms behind exercise capacity in adults with type 2 diabetes mellitus (T2DM), focusing on central and peripheral components, as described by the Fick equation.
Methods: A cross-sectional study of 141 adults with T2DM was conducted, using cardiopulmonary exercise testing, near-infrared spectroscopy (NIRS) and exercise echocardiography. Participants with sufficient-quality NIRS data were stratified into tertiles based on percentage predicted VO₂peak.

There is a lack of longitudinal data on type 2 diabetes (T2D) in low- and middle-income countries. We leveraged the electronic health records (EHR) system of a publicly funded academic institution to establish a retrospective cohort with longitudinal data to facilitate benchmarking, surveillance, and resource planning of a multi-ethnic T2D population in Malaysia. This cohort included 15,702 adults aged ≥ 18 years with T2D who received outpatient care (January 2002-December 2020) from Universiti Malaya Medical Centre (UMMC), Kuala Lumpur, Malaysia.

Importance: As obesity rates rise in the US, managing associated metabolic comorbidities presents a growing burden to the health care system. While bariatric surgery has shown promise in mitigating established metabolic conditions, no large studies have quantified the risk of developing major obesity-related comorbidities after bariatric surgery.
Objective: To identify common metabolic phenotypes for patients eligible for bariatric surgery and to estimate crude and adjusted incidence rates of additional metabolic comorbidities associated with bariatric surgery compared with weight management program (WMP) alone.
